Itasca County Sheriff's Office, Minnesota
End of Watch Monday, March 28, 1977

Deputy Sheriff Junita Badavinac was killed in an automobile accident while assisting at the scene of a fire.
She had just finished her shift and was on her way home when she observed several kids around the fire. She had moved kids away from one side of the fire and was driving across the railroad tracks to the other side when her car struck a bridge abutment. The collision caused her to suffer a heart attack.
Deputy Badavinac was survived by her husband and three children.
